GK Energy Limited's IPO monitoring report for Q4 FY26 shows the company has utilized Rs. 388.93 crore (97.2%) of its Rs. 400 crore IPO proceeds. Working capital requirements (Rs. 322.46 crore) and General Corporate Purposes (Rs. 46.48 crore) have been fully deployed. Issue-related expenses stand at Rs. 19.99 crore with Rs. 11.07 crore remaining unutilized, held in HDFC Bank and IndusInd Bank accounts. CARE Ratings confirms no deviation from stated objects and no major changes from prior reports. The company completed its objects ahead of the March 31, 2026 timeline. However, the report notes that Maharashtra GST Department conducted search proceedings in February-March 2026 and disallowed certain input tax credits, though the order is appealable.
The clean bill of health from the monitoring agency on IPO fund utilization is positive for investor confidence. The GST department inquiry and input tax credit disallowance warrants monitoring as it could have future tax liability implications, though the matter is currently being evaluated for appeal.
